#12c51c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12c51c is composed of 7.1% red, 77.3%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 123.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#12c51c color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ff38 with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#12c51c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#12c51c has RGB values of R:18, G:197,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1230108.

Shades and Tints of #12c51c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#12c51c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#657265 is the less saturated color, while #01d60d is the most saturated one.
